Elon Musk and other tech leaders call for AI development pause over fear of putting society at risk

Citing concerns over the probable repercussion of the advancement of artificial intelligence, Elon Musk, along with experts and tech industry execs, are calling for a six-month hiatus to the creation of a more robust Artificial Intelligence (AI) than OpenAI’s recently newly GPT-4.

Backed by Microsoft, OpenAI revealed the 4th rendition of the Generative Pre-trained Transformer (GPT) AI program earlier in the month, whose capability to mimic human-like creativity had impressed many users.

A letter issued by the Future of Life Institute cites how “powerful AI systems” must only be developed once the effects are sure to be positive and the risk attributed to them be made manageable.

Per the European Union’s transparency register, the aforementioned non-profit organization is primarily under the funding of the Musk Foundation in addition to the Silicon Valley Community Foundation and Founders Pledge.

Artificial-Intelligence-Healthcare-Medicine

Earlier in the month, a co-founder of OpenAI, Elon Musk, openly admitted how artificial intelligence “stresses” him out. 

Musk showed frustration over the fact that regulators were critical of any attempt to oversee the autopilot system and thus called for a regulatory body to guarantee that the development of AI is in line with the public interest.

Despite garnering support through more than 1,000 signatures, including Musk, other leaders in tech, such as OpenAI’s Chief Executive Sam Altman, Alphabet CEO Sundar Pichai, and Microsoft CEO Satya Nadella, were not on the list who made the signatures.

Globe Prepaid eSIM is finally available

At long last, Globe has finally released its Prepaid eSIM. The Globe Prepaid eSIM launched about 8 months after they first teased the service in August 2023, around 5 months since a prepaid eSIM was offered exclusively to travelers , and about 6 years since they offered eSIMs for postpaid users. If you own modern iPhones and other compatible devices and want to have a Globe eSIM installed on your phone without being tied to a postpaid plan, you can now do so by purchasing one on the GlobeOne app. Related How to check Globe load and data balance How to use Globe, TM to call telephone numbers The Globe Prepaid eSIM has a price of Php99 and comes with a free 5GB of data and unlimited texts to all networks valid for three days after registration. Sadly, no free calls. To purchase, simply open the GlobeOne app > tap Life Essentials > and under Get a Globe Connection, tap Prepaid eSIM. Dingdong Hatid MC Taxi service coming soon

Dingdong PH, the delivery service owned by Filipino actor and businessman Dingdong Dantes, is set to expand its services by entering the motorcycle taxi business. Dingdong PH, with the help of RiderKo, was first introduced as a motorcycle delivery company for small businesses that need their goods delivered directly to customers. Now, they are looking to expand with their new Dingdong Hatid service. Dingdong PH started teasing their Hatid service in their Facebook page on February 1. Since then, we’ve seen posts encouraging motorists to become their MC taxi riders.
